Homeowners always see floor stains as a headache. Cleaning floor stains due to oil, grease, grime, road salt, and dirt penetrating the garage is very hard to clean. It’s a good thing that there are many garage floor cleaners being sold today. But which one of them works best for you?
To know that, first, you have to determine the real cause of the stain in your garage floor. The type of garage covering you use should also be considered. For painted garage floors, the simplest solution could just be the application of a fresh new coat of paint over the problem spot.

Your garage door is most likely the largest moving piece of machinery in your home. Some of them weigh in at several hundred pounds. Replacement costs can be high, especially when coupled with a new opener. Take a look at the following five things you can do to ensure yours lasts as long as possible. Just once year, have a professional come to perform some simple maintenance on your system. It should cost less than $100 to have a company adjust both the opener and spring system if needed. You might know many people who use their garage as a storage room. They will put any thing but their vehicle in the garage. They will rather expose their car to a crappy weather then to clean out the use less junk in their garage. Using your garage for your vehicle will preserve the appearance of your car. It will also keep it running more effectively. Especially in the winter time, if you park your car in the garage it will make it way easier since you wouldn’t have to scrape the ice from the windshield. Garages need to be cleaned and organized just like a home needs to be. Many families choose to purchase garage organizers and containers so that all of their tools will be put away. Many supply stores sell items that hold mops and brooms; closets that supply space for shovels and garden equipment; and even bike holders that fit on the wall or ceiling of the garage to hang your family’s bicycles.
